Andras Nemeth and James Holzhauer Release
James Holzhauer raised to 30,000 in the hijack and the cutoff called. From the small blind, Andras Nemeth three-bet to 150,000.
Holzhauer and the cutoff both called as the flop landed [JdQd5c].
Nemeth and Holzhauer checked, and the cutoff bet 325,000. Nemeth thought for a little before folding, and when the action turned to Holzhauer, he folded too.

Turn Check-Raise From partypoker Chairman Mike Sexton
From early position, partypoker Chaiman Mike Sexton opened and was called by the players in the cutoff and the big blind.
The flop was [Kc4h6h] and action checked to Sexton who continued for 55,000. Only the player in the cutoff called.
The turn was the [8c], Sexton checked, his opponent bet 130,000, Sexton check-raised to effectively 470,000-ish and his opponent folded.

Maria Ho Runs into Queens

On a flop of [5c6s2c] with roughly 250,000 in the middle, Maria Ho bet out 115,000 from the small blind and the big blind called.
The turn fell the [Jh] and Ho bet 280,000. Her opponent called, and then both players checked the [Jc] on the river.
Ho tabled her [Kc6d], but it would be her opponent’s [QhQs] that would earn him the pot.

Kelly Minkin Slips
Kelly Minkin raised to 30,000 from the button and the player in the big blind called.
The flop was [AhQh3h] and the big blind check-called 25,000 from Minkin.
The turn was the [9c] and the big blind check-called 125,000 from Minkin.
The river was the [6h] and both players checked.
The player in the big blind showed [As6s] for two aces and sixes, Minkin mucked and her opponent won the pot.

Set for Mike Leah Over James Romero

On a board of [AdTc3sJh7c] with roughly 330,000 in the middle, Mike Leah checked from the small blind to James Romero in the cutoff who bet 80,000.
Leah responded with a check-raise to 380,000 and Romero called.
Leah tabled his [3h3c] for bottom set, and Romero folded.
